On Saturday evening I met this female intending to sleep on a Centaurea flowerhead bud. I see a small red spot on the base of the mid tibia, only hairs and no bristles on the underside of femur 1, and yellow marginal bristles on the scutellum - this points to Machimus rusticus. Do you agree, or are there better candidates? Locality is southwestern Germany, 20 km west of Stuttgart.
